A man robbed a TCF Bank branch inside a Jewel-Osco store Thursday afternoon on the North Side.
It happened at 3:40 p.m. at 4250 N. Lincoln Ave., according to the FBI, which described the robber as black, in his 20s, about 6-feet tall and 130 pounds, wearing a black wig and sunglasses over a black hooded sweatshirt with red sleeves, dark jeans and gray shoes. He didn’t show a weapon, authorities said.
The FBI is offering a cash reward for information leading to an arrest. Tips can be left at (312) 421-6700.
According to the FBI, 175 banks have been robbed in the Chicago area this year, up from 114 last year.
